Job Description

*The candidate must have eligibility to work full-time in the UK*
We’re looking for Software Development Engineers who is passionate about technology, loves solving customer problems, and delivers the high quality work. We are looking for someone who has a particular interest in building cloud (AWS) services and data pipelines to address challenging engineering problems.

Job responsibilities

  • Building data ingestion pipelines (event-based and scheduled).
  • Writing Java-based services to consume and process data from external APIs
  • Building cloud infrastructure on AWS including using AWS CDK.
  • Building automated processes to test data quality
  • Being part of an agile development team

Requirements

  • Passion for delivery high-quality code
  • 5+ years experience writing commercial-grade Java software applications.
  • Test-driven development, which includes Unit and End-to-End Testing
  • Experience with Agile software development (Scrum).
  • Experience with continuous integration and deployment approaches and tools.
  • Bachelor or Master degree in Computer Science, Engineering, Physics, Math, or relevant related work experience.
  • 2+ years cloud development experience writing infrastructure as code (AWS essential)

Desirable

  • Experience with Apache Airflow (including AWS MWAA)

Job Types: Full-time, Temporary contract, Fixed term contract

Schedule:

  • Day shift
  • Monday to Friday
  • Night shift
  • Weekend availability


Work authorisation:

  • United Kingdom (required)